September, ca. 1907 - Capturing the Essence of Rural America
EDITORS COMMENTS
. In this oil painting by William Anderson Coffin, we are transported back to the idyllic countryside of early 20th century America. The scene depicts a picturesque autumn landscape, where golden fields stretch as far as the eye can see. It is harvest time, and farmers diligently gather their bountiful crops. Coffin's attention to detail is evident in every brushstroke; he masterfully captures the essence of rural life during this era. The vibrant colors bring warmth and life to the canvas, showcasing nature's beauty at its peak. The painting not only showcases the agricultural heritage of America but also serves as an educational tool for future generations. It provides a glimpse into a bygone era when farming was not just a means of sustenance but also deeply intertwined with American identity.
